Abstract
540,586. Exciting dynamo-electric machines. MAWDSLEY'S, Ltd., and JONES, N. W. May 7, 1940, No. 8212. [Class 35] In a machine in which the excitation is derived from a shunt or compound wound exciter and in which a main field regulator is in series with the armature of the exciter a rectifying device is arranged in circuit with the exciter-shunt winding so as to prevent a demagnetising-current from flowing through it when the regulator Ýs quickly inserted to shut down the machine. Fig. 1 shows such a machine 1 with a main field winding 4 a main regulating resistance 8 and an exciter 2 having a shunt field-winding. A metal oxide rectifier 9 is connected in series with the winding of the machine armature so as only to pass current in the direction for normal operation of the machine. In a modification the rectifier is in parallel with the winding 7 so as to byepass reverse current.
